INTRODUCTION

The AFRICA Dental Fluoride Treatment Market focuses on the development, production, and application of fluoride-based treatments that strengthen tooth enamel, prevent cavities, and combat tooth decay. Dental fluoride treatments are widely used in preventive dentistry for children, adults, and elderly patients, playing a crucial role in maintaining oral health and reducing dental caries.

Key types of dental fluoride treatments include:

  • Topical Fluoride Treatments: Professionally applied fluoride gels, foams, and varnishes used in dental clinics.
  • Fluoride Toothpastes: Over-the-counter products containing fluoride to prevent cavities through daily use.
  • Fluoride Mouth Rinses: Prescription and non-prescription rinses for strengthening enamel and preventing decay.
  • Fluoride Supplements: Tablets or drops for individuals in fluoride-deficient areas.
  • Fluoridated Water Treatments: Community-wide programs to improve dental health through water fluoridation.

CHALLENGES IN THE AFRICA DENTAL FLUORIDE TREATMENT MARKET

Despite its potential, the dental fluoride treatment market in AFRICA faces several challenges:

  • Fluoride Overexposure Risks: Excessive fluoride intake can lead to dental fluorosis, causing concerns about fluoride safety in AFRICA.
  • Limited Awareness in Rural Areas: Lack of dental education and access to fluoride treatments in underserved regions hampers market growth in AFRICA.
  • Competition from Alternative Therapies: Natural and fluoride-free dental products are gaining traction, posing competition for fluoride treatments in AFRICA.
  • Cost of Professional Fluoride Treatments: For some populations, the cost of professional fluoride applications may limit adoption in AFRICA.
  • Regulatory Hurdles: Stringent regulations for fluoride content in dental products can delay approvals and market entry in AFRICA.
